additional remarks | The computer systems lab is an advanced course where the students will work on an open-source project. The students will work on practical and state-of-the-art computer systems to evaluate them, dissect them, reveal their internals, and modify them to add new features. Overall, the course focuses on learning the art of building computer systems by deploying, analyzing, reproducing, and breaking practical computer systems! The term computer systems cover a broad range of topics: distributed systems, systems for machine learning/AI, systems security, large-scale data analytics systems, storage systems, operating systems, filesystems, databases, synchronization/concurrency primitives, compiler-assisted systems, dependability, reliability, cloud/edge computing, IoT systems, etc. In short, we will focus on software systems that solve important practical problems. The students are encouraged to contribute to the open-source project by creating a pull request to get their feature(s) merged into the project. There will be bonus points for students with accepted pull requests. Additionally, the top students will be nominated/encouraged to participate in the artifact evaluation committee for the top computer systems conferences: OSDI, SOSP, ASPLOS, EuroSys, etc. Please find more info here: https://github.com/TUM-DSE/sys-lab |
